Students who are past their Bar/Bat Mitzvah year are invited to become Madrichim (Leaders) in Kehilla School, serving as teacher’s aides, supervising snack, and doing projects to support children’s learning. After an initial training period, Madrichim earn minimum wage, currently $8.00 per hour. Midrasha
Midrasha provides the East Bay Jewish Community a continuation of Jewish learning for Middle School and High School students, in a supplementary setting. Midrasha students enthusiastically talk about learning to question, form ethical opinions, and expanding their Jewish identities. Midrasha has two campuses, one in Berkeley and one in Oakland. The main program, Berkeley Midrasha, meets on Sunday mornings, and Oakland Midrasha meets on Tuesday evenings. Kehilla provides financial support to students in both programs.
